Originally Posted by jfairladyz
So what if it makes the most horsepower per liter of any NA engine. How about making the most torque.
yup, all they did was configure the engine like a lot of people do when they change their streetable engine to more of a high rpm race engine.

You can get 200+ whp out of an L28 but the low end suffers. Balance it, port it too much, put in a long duration cam and you've got all high end power. The L28 makes more torque than horsepower and the 350Z was designed so it would have usable power in all RPMs. Thats good engine design; pumping out the most peak horsepower is not a 'good' deisgn, it just looks good on paper.
